Osun Amotekun Arrests Man Who Stole N1.2 Million Cash And Jewelleries From His Landlady In Ogun

The suspect said he was the one taking care of the landlady, which allows him to get access to the woman’s room.

Osun State chapter of Amotekun, a Western Nigeria Security Network, has apprehended a suspected robber identified as Mumeen Saheed with a sum of N1.2 million cash and jewelleries in Osogbo area of the state.

The 36-year-old suspected robber was arrested on Friday while wandering around with the properties which he claimed to have stolen since February from his former landlady who lives around the Local Government Secretariat area of Shagamu, Ogun State.

The suspect who confessed to having spent part of the money, said he was the one taking care of the landlady, which allows him to get access to the woman’s room.

Mumeen told Amotekun corps that he had kept the money in the bush while shuttling between Ibadan and Osogbo waiting for COVID 19 to end, so he could rent a house and settle down.

The Field Commander of Amotekun, Comrade Amitolu Shittu, said, the properties recovered from the suspect have been handed over to the Nigeria Police, Oja-Oba Division, Osogbo, for further investigations.

Also recovered from the suspect were assorted charms and the picture of an expatriate he claimed was brought to him by a client for prayer.

The field commander, who warned evildoers to be conscious of consequence, reiterated that the security outfit would not let down the people of Osun.
